Michael R. Chin Quee

Executive Vice President of Church Alliances

Michael R. Chin Quee, Executive Vice President of Church Alliances, is responsible for overseeing Food For The Poor’s (FFTP) relationships with churches. He leads the charity’s church expansion in the United States and in the primarily 17 Latin American and Caribbean countries where the organization works. Michael previously served as Director of Donor Relations for 13 years and then became the Director of Operations for the Church Alliances Division before his promotion to lead the division in January 2022.

Michael has a heart for the lost, a passion for God’s Word, and deep compassion for poverty-stricken children and families, all guided by The Great Commandment and The Great Commission. He has been teaching the Bible for the past 20 years.

Michael is a Lay Leader in his church and presently serves as and a leader in Men’s Ministry. He has also served as the Church Secretary. Additionally, he leads an online weekly evening Bible Study for FFTP team members interested in exploring The Word together. Michael is a Jamaican-born U.S. citizen who migrated to the United States in 1984 and worked for several Fortune 500 Companies. He is a graduate of Maranatha Christian College, where he received a Bachelor of Arts degree in Theology. He lives in Coral Springs, Fla., with his wife, Celia. They have one adult son who lives on Florida’s southwest coast.
